Military Resale Group Growth Defies Slow Economy; Product Line Expansion Improves Bottom Line

COLORADO SPRINGS, Colo.--(BUSINESS WIRE)--July 15, 2003--Military Resale Group (OTCBB: MYRG), a distributor to the military commissary system, is making significant progress in its growth strategy. MYRG has achieved 24.1% year over year growth in total revenues in Q1 2003, despite the continued slow economy. The growth is largely as a result of the company's progress in its planned product line expansion -- the first phase of a two-fold growth strategy. MYRG's growth strategy also entails accretive acquisitions of competitive or complementary commissary distributors, which MYRG believes offer even greater growth potential.

"We're very fortunate to be in an industry that historically has remained strong through a wide variety of economic conditions and military actions," said Ethan Hokit, president of Military Resale Group. "Our stable customer base of more than 13 million eligible military commissary patrons, with the majority of them being military family members, reservists and retired personnel, continue to buy food and package goods during economic downturns and military actions. They view the pricing discount of up to approximately 30 percent offered by commissaries as one of their key benefits and often travel twice the distance to use commissaries over retail grocery stores."

Product Line Expansion Continues

Since January, Military Resale Group has added approximately 30 SKUs from leading brands and manufacturers to its product line, most recently Mrs. Smith pies and cobblers and the new, hot-selling Snak King GuacaChips and other snack items. MYRG is currently in negotiations with a number of additional product manufacturers and distributors and plans to add numerous items to its product line by year-end.

Each new product line is expected to improve MYRG's bottom line. The Company selects only best selling and/or unique products that fill a need for commissary patrons. An additional requirement is that the products provide favorable margins for MYRG. MYRG's new warehouse and cold storage facility has capacity to serve 2.5 times more volume for the bases in its region. Leveraging this capacity, MYRG expects that as new products are added, additional overhead costs will be minimal, allowing for increased profit margins.

Accretive Acquisition Strategy To Fuel Future Growth

MYRG plans to supplement its organic growth through the acquisition of complementary military distribution companies and related businesses that already have established contracts with leading manufacturers and strong customer relationships with military bases.

"Our roll-up strategy is intended to yield new product inventory for all served bases, create economies of scale, and enable negotiation of better pricing due to expanded distribution," Hokit stated. "Leveraging our planned geographical spread, MYRG will be in a position to drive growth by offering major and regional manufacturers attractive opportunities to outsource or sell their military business to us. Since the military market is only a small portion of manufacturers' overall sales compared to the resources they have to devote to the U.S. Defense Commissary Agency (DeCA) regulation and procedure compliance, manufacturers have indicated a willingness to outsource this portion of their business to a specialist, like MYRG, that can serve the market more cost effectively."

Overall, the company's growth strategy is expected to continue the 24% year over year revenue growth seen in first quarter 2003, while significantly enhancing shareholder value.

About Military Resale Group, Inc.

Military Resale Group, Inc. is a regional marketer and distributor of a wide range of foods and consumer packaged goods to U.S. military base commissaries, which are large supermarket-style stores operated by DeCA. MYRG resells frozen foods, canned and dry goods, meat, poultry, seafood, dairy products, beverages, paper goods, and cleaning supplies from consumer products manufacturers to commissaries, providing commissary patrons a cost savings of up to approximately 30%, a valuable benefit to military personnel and their families.

With a focus on unique specialty products, MYRG targets both unfulfilled markets and new niche markets that demonstrate high-growth potential in local retail markets. MYRG leverages its management's 50 years of experience in the military resale market to service commissaries at six major U.S. military installations in Colorado, Wyoming and South Dakota. Headquartered in Colorado Springs, MYRG became a publicly held company in 2001 and believes it is one of the fastest growing companies in the military resale industry.
